The Families of the Temagami First Nation have occupied the lands and waters 
in the Temagami area as stewards for thousands of years. The Temagami First 
Nation is the Body Politic of the 800 Teme-Augama Anishnabai, who are presently 
recognized as Indians under the Indian Act of Canada.

The flag is horizontally divided blue over black with a central white disk depicting the totem animals of the families of the Nation: kingfisher, loon, caribou, rattlesnake, beaver, muskrat arranged around a central red disk.
